I propose to take Questions Nos. 1251 and 1256 together.
The Social Housing Leasing Programme, the Housing Assistance Payment (HAP) and the Rental Accommodation Scheme (RAS) are all critical components of the accelerated delivery of social housing envisaged under Rebuilding Ireland: Action Plan for Housing and Homelessness.
The position in Longford and Westmeath, as at end 2019, for each of these schemes is set out in the following table:
Local Authority | Leased Units | Active HAP Tenancies | RAS Tenancies |
---|---|---|---|
Longford | 116 | 330 | 209 |
Westmeath | 354 | 901 | 569 |
The number of persons on the housing transfer list is a matter for the relevant local authority.
